The effects on the six significant kavalactones on cDNA-derived CYP450 isoenzymes were being evaluated by Zou et al. [47] who shown that desmethoxyyangonin exhibited by far the most strong inhibition on CYP1A2. In the case of CYP2C19, the main inhibitors have been dihydromethysticin, desmethoxyyangonin and methysticin, even though for CYP3A4, methysticin and dihydromethysticin evidenced the top inhibitory effects.
